Material Integrity & Craftsmanship
At Oak Castle Furniture, we believe that the ‘bones’ of a piece of furniture are just as important as its finish. Beneath the smooth, light grey exterior lies a commitment to traditional joinery that ensures longevity. Unlike flat-pack alternatives that rely on cam-locks and dowels, this lamp table is delivered fully assembled, a testament to its solid construction.
The Solid Oak Top: The crowning glory of this piece is its thick, natural oak top. We select timber with character—meaning you will see the authentic grain patterns, medullary rays, and subtle knots that tell the story of the tree. This top is treated with a resilient satin lacquer, which not only enhances the wood’s natural warmth but also provides a hard-wearing shield against coffee cup rings and everyday wear. It creates a stunning two-tone contrast against the painted base, bringing a touch of organic warmth to the cool grey finish.
Dovetail Joinery: Pull open the drawer, and you will find traditional dovetail joints. This interlocking construction method resists the pulling force applied when opening a drawer, ensuring that the front never separates from the sides, even after years of daily use. The drawer runs on solid wooden runners, providing that satisfying, tactile friction that only comes from real wood furniture.

Maintenance & Care for Longevity
Investing in quality painted furniture means you want it to look pristine for years. The paint finish on our Light Grey Painted Lamp Table is hard-wearing, but like all fine furniture, it deserves respect.
- Cleaning: For daily maintenance, simply dust with a soft, dry microfibre cloth. Avoid using silicone-based polishes or harsh sprays (like common kitchen surface cleaners), as these can degrade the lacquer on the oak top or soften the paint finish over time. A slightly damp cloth is sufficient for sticky marks, followed immediately by a dry one.
- Sunlight & Heat: While the finish is UV resistant, we recommend avoiding placement in direct, scorching sunlight (such as directly in front of a south-facing patio door) to prevent uneven fading over decades. Always use coasters for hot drinks; while the lacquer is durable, prolonged exposure to high heat can cause ‘blooming’ (white marks) on the oak wax finish.
- Positioning: If placing on a wooden floor, consider felt pads for the feet to protect both the table and your flooring, especially if the table will be moved frequently to access hallway power points.
